All her life, my mother wanted busy children. It was very important that her house should remain at all times clean and tidy.
You could turn your back for a moment in my mother’s house, leave a half-written letter on the dining room table, a magazine open on the chair, and turn around to find my mother had "put it back where it belonged", as she explained.
My wife, on one of her first visits to my mother’s house, placed a packet of biscuits on an end table and went to the kitchen to fetch a drink. When she returned, she found the packet had been removed. Confused, she set down her drink and went back to the kitchen for more biscuits only to return to find that her drink had disappeared. Up to then she had guessed that everyone in my family held onto their drinks, so as not to make water rings on the end table. Now she knows better.
These disappearances had a confusing effect on our family. We were all inclined to forgetfulness, and it was common for one of us, upon returning from the bathroom, to find that every sign of his work in progress had disappeared suddenly. "Do you remember what I was doing?" was a question frequently asked, but rarely answered.
Now my sister has developed a second-hand love of clean windows, and my brother does the cleaning in his house, perhaps to avoid having to be the one to lift his feet. I try not to think about it too much, but I have at this later time started to dust the furniture once a week.
Questions 26 to 28 are based on the passage you have just heard.
26. Which is true about the speaker’s mother?
27. Why couldn’t the speaker’s wife find her biscuits and drink in his mother’s house?
28. What does the passage mainly tell us?
选项
A、She enjoyed removing others’ drinks.
B、She became more and more forgetful.
C、She preferred to do everything by herself.
D、She wanted to keep her house in good order.
答案
D
解析
选项中的She,enjoyed,forgetful,preferred to等表明,本题考查She的特点。根据短文中提到的my mother…It was very important…her house…remain at all times clean and tidy可知,母亲总是希望屋里干净整洁,故答案为D),其中in good order意为“整齐,井然有序”。
